Notes on the SANHS New Content Google Site
The New Content site has been set up so that SANHS members can put website content easily and directly into public view.
The purpose
of the site:
1. To display SANHS members' web material in a live and immediate way, and
encourage interaction with the web
2. To provide links and news in the eclectic field of subjects that is represented
by SANHS
3. For the wider public to view and be interested.
Uploading
Content:
1. Arrange for your email address to be cleared for editing rights, with me,
or with the SANHS office
for passing on.
2. Bring up the site in your browser - all browsers should be effective.
3. Go to the 'sign in' link at the bottom left of the page, and register or
log in to your own Google Account using your email address as the user name.
This will then take you back to the SANHS New Content site with editing functions
now available.
4. Use the Home Page or make your own page if you prefer.
5. Write or copy and paste text. Text can be made into a link.
6. Either 'insert' images for them to appear as images on the page, or 'attach'
if they are large files or pdfs. The browse dialogue box that appears will
not be invading your hard drive, but is setting up the outward route for your
selected file to the site.
7. Images should ideally be jpegs at about 72 dpi, which is the native resolution
of most computer screens. Use RGB colour, better than CMYK. The image dimensions
should then be as you would like it to appear on the screen. 'Attach' the
image if you would like it to remain full size. Contact me for more help.
8. Use the table function to lay out your page.
9. Leave some sign of your identity as the author, for me at least.
10. Be prepared for delays in response from Google at any stage. There appears
to be a queuing system, so have other things to do while you are patiently
waiting to avoid frustration!
11. Sign out

Content placed
here may sometimes be suitable for inclusion in the main SANHS site, and so
the web manager may copy or move sections across from time to time. On the
main site material will become more 'accessible'. The web manager may also
moderate the site, but only in extremis because variety of expression is in
the main a good thing!
Content may also be copied for the printed SANHS newsletter
The SANHS Members' Page is shortly to become a password protected area of the site available only to members, and a SANHS Message Board will then be available there for members' comments, gripes and discussion (also subject to moderation). However the SANHS New Content site will be open to view to the public - the world - with the slightly different function to the message board.
Only members with an email address authorised for the site will be able to post material. Please submit this to the website manager or to the SANHS office for forwarding, if you wish to participate.
Note that any material posted will feature in search engines. Key words and phrases will then attract interested web users in the public, so the more the better.
